Question from a 66' Burb guy

Hi Fella's, hope you don't mind me posting here but I thought as Burb guys you may have some advice. I have a 66' Burb and the seat setup is 60/40 for the front seats with the short side on the passenger side. This seat tumbles forward for access to the 2nd row. You guys get that extra door, I'm not so fortunate.

I'm thinking of updating to a late model seat setup, my wife is not crazy about the current factory seats. I was thinking a late model 90's Suburban 2nd row seat for my 1st row, it has a similar folding seat setup for 3rd row access. Would you guys have a suggestions for a similar seat that might work?
